Multilin UR9GH 中央处理器模块是 GE Multilin 系列中的一个关键组件,主要用于电力保护和控制系统中。以下是对这一模块的一些详细信息,包括其特点和应用领域:
主要特点
中央处理功能:
- 处理核心:作为系统的中央处理单元,负责处理所有电力保护、监测和控制任务。
- 运算能力:具备高性能的处理能力,能够实时处理和分析大量电力系统数据。
集成性:
- 系统集成:与其他保护模块、输入/输出模块和通讯模块无缝集成,形成完整的电力保护系统。
- 多功能性:集成了多种功能模块,如保护、控制、监测和数据记录。
通讯能力:
- 通讯协议:支持多种通讯协议(如Modbus、DNP3、IEC 61850),确保与其他系统和设备的兼容性。
- 数据接口:提供多种数据接口,包括以太网、串口等,用于系统集成和数据传输。
配置与控制:
- 用户界面:提供友好的用户界面,方便进行系统配置、监控和操作。
- 远程访问:支持远程访问功能,允许操作员通过网络进行远程配置和维护。
安全和可靠性:
- 高可靠性设计:采用高可靠性设计,能够在严苛的环境条件下稳定运行。
- 冗余功能:可能具备冗余功能,以增加系统的可靠性和故障容错能力。
数据管理:
- 数据记录:记录电力系统的实时数据和历史数据,用于故障分析和性能评估。
- 事件日志:保存事件日志和操作记录,支持故障排查和系统优化。

The Multilin UR9GH central processing unit module is a key component in the GE Multilin series, mainly used in power protection and control systems. The following is some detailed information about this module, including its characteristics and application fields:
main features
Central processing function:
Processing core: As the central processing unit of the system, responsible for handling all power protection, monitoring, and control tasks.
Computational ability: Possess high-performance processing capability, capable of real-time processing and analysis of large amounts of power system data.
Integration:
System integration: seamlessly integrate with other protection modules, input/output modules, and communication modules to form a complete power protection system.
Multifunctionality: Integrated with multiple functional modules such as protection, control, monitoring, and data recording.
Communication ability:
Communication Protocol: Supports multiple communication protocols (such as Modbus DNP3、IEC 61850), Ensure compatibility with other systems and devices.
Data interface: Provides multiple data interfaces, including Ethernet, serial port, etc., for system integration and data transmission.
Configuration and Control:
User Interface: Provides a user-friendly interface for easy system configuration, monitoring, and operation.
Remote Access: Supports remote access functionality, allowing operators to remotely configure and maintain through the network.
Safety and reliability:
High reliability design: Adopting a high reliability design, it can operate stably under harsh environmental conditions.
Redundancy function: It may have redundancy function to increase the reliability and fault tolerance of the system.
Data management:
Data recording: Record real-time and historical data of the power system for fault analysis and performance evaluation.
Event log: Save event logs and operation records, support troubleshooting and system optimization.
